Transaction 9306fc9145f697ec7c23b6c2e7e0843a097b67c042abef683bbe2387bbeb9d8e

1 Input
1 Outputs
  • 9306fc9145f697ec7c23b6c2e7e0843a097b67c042abef683bbe2387bbeb9d8e:0
  • value  733052
    address  3LqVEBvChyx13TDwPaKkoHXQE38PvUF7Se